Tequila is too mainstream, you should try mezcal and pulque (the beverage of gods). There are plenty of places to go out downtown, in La Roma and La Condesa, to hang out and dance. I would recommend you visiting Chapultepec, Coyoacan, San Angel and Tlalpan, all of them places full of history. Also Teotihuacan pyramids is a must! Overall food is cheap (unless you go to expensive posh restaurants) and there are tacos in each street corner. Also downtown there are some cheap hostels. With 25 bucks you could live like a king sightseeing and drinking incluided. Also weed is cheap here.

*Note about the JR Pass*
Many people ask about whether or not the JR Rail Pass is worth it. It depends on your itinerary.

>http://www.hyperdia.com/en/
Plug your itinerary into Hyperdia to determine ticket costs, then compare to the below JR Pass options:
>7 day Pass: 29,110¥
>14 day Pass: 46,390¥
>21 day Pass: 59,350¥
